About CytomX Therapeutics, Inc.

CytomX Therapeutics, Inc. is a United States-based biopharmaceutical company primarily focused on creating treatments for cancer. The company utilizes its proprietary Probody technology platform to engineer targeted antibody therapeutics for oncological applications. Its robust clinical pipeline includes several notable drug candidates. CX-2009, an antibody-drug conjugate (ADC) designed to target CD166, is currently in Phase II clinical trials for treating breast cancer. Another investigational therapy, CX-2029, has also reached Phase II trials, where it is being evaluated for various cancers such as squamous non-small cell lung cancer, head and neck squamous cell carcinoma, esophageal and gastro-esophageal junction cancers, and diffuse large B-cell lymphoma. Additionally, CytomX is progressing two CTLA-4 Probody therapeutics: BMS-986249, which is undergoing Phase I/II clinical trials for metastatic melanoma, and BMS-986288, in Phase I trials for solid tumors. Beyond these, the company is developing CX-2043, a conditionally activated ADC targeting the epithelial cell adhesion molecule, and CX-904, a conditionally activated epidermal growth factor receptor, both aimed at addressing solid tumor conditions. CytomX has forged strategic partnerships with leading pharmaceutical firms, including AbbVie Ireland Unlimited Company, Amgen, Inc., Bristol-Myers Squibb Company, ImmunoGen, Inc., Pfizer Inc., and Astellas Pharma Inc., to collaboratively advance its Probody therapeutics. The company was founded in 2008 and its main office is located in South San Francisco, California.

Why did CytomX Therapeutics, Inc. get a B+ compliance rating?
CytomX Therapeutics, Inc. (CTMX) received a grade of B+ (Good) based on three AAOIFI Standard 21 financial ratios: debt-to-market-cap of 0.7% (limit 30%); interest-bearing deposits of 23.3% (limit 30%); prohibited income of 1.88% (limit 5%). The grade reflects the margin of safety across all three ratios relative to their thresholds.
What could change CytomX Therapeutics, Inc.'s Shariah verdict?
CytomX Therapeutics, Inc.'s verdict is re-evaluated at each annual re-screen. Three events could change it: (1) the debt-to-market-cap ratio crossing 30%, typically from new debt issuance or a major drop in share price; (2) interest-bearing deposits exceeding 30% of market cap; or (3) prohibited revenue (alcohol, gambling, conventional finance, etc.) exceeding 5% of total revenue.
